We produce visualisations of property interiors, either from photographs of an existing space or from architectural floor plans. The purpose is to help a viewer understand a space — its scale, layout and possible use.
To be explicit about what this is not: we are not interior designers or architects. We do not provide design specification, product sourcing, project management, or advice on what should be built or installed. Our visuals are not architectural drawings, construction documents, or a representation that any particular furniture will be supplied with a property.
We work from the material you supply and reproduce the space as it is: we do not move walls, alter room dimensions, change ceiling heights, improve views, or conceal defects. Where a floor plan is the source, the visualisation reflects the plan as drawn.
You remain responsible for how the images are used in your marketing, and for ensuring your marketing complies with the property advertising rules that apply to you. In most jurisdictions virtually furnished images must be clearly identified as such. We supply files labelled as visualisations for this reason, and you agree not to present them as unedited photographs of a furnished property.

Every quote includes revision rounds; the number is stated in the quote. A revision means adjusting the delivered visual in response to your feedback — scale, placement, styling, lighting. It does not mean a new visual of a different room or a change of brief, which is new work.
Timelines quoted run from the point we have everything we need from you, not from the date you accept. If you have a launch or listing date, tell us before you accept the quote and we will confirm in writing whether we can meet it.
